What a child, family, and school social workers earns in the US
According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ics OEWS May 2025 national estimates, a child, family, and school social workers (SOC 21-1021) earns a median annual wage of $59,550 and a mean (average) of $64,000. The median is the midpoint — half of child, family, and school social workers earn more and half earn less — and is 17% above the US all-occupations median of $50,980. The mean is higher than the median when a minority of very high earners pull the average up.
Note: BLS top-codes any annual wage at or above $239,200/year, so occupations at that ceiling share the same figure.
